## Further reading

If you're auditing Vernalis, know that sensor drift compensation is where most of the spooky logic lives. The controller trusts humidity probes for up to 40 hours past calibration, then blends in neighbor readings — which means a compromised node can nudge its neighbors' corrections. Worth a close look. We wrote up the drift model, trust windows, and past incidents on an internal page.

operations page: https://jenkins.zemvarcloud.local/job/merge_requests/repo/build/73930b4b30f0a8ed

Subject: Quickstore 4.2 — bloom filter now fronts the KV layer

Plugin authors: starting with this release, Quickstore places a bloom filter ahead of the key-value store. Negative lookups return faster; false positives fall through safely. No API changes are required on your side. Verify your plugin against the staging build referenced below.

session token of fahif-tadup = htk3_9c7

# Approvals: Profile Store Sharding

Heads up, plugin authors: the Nimbuslane user-profile store is moving from a single cluster to hash-based shards. If your plugin queries profiles directly (you shouldn't, but we know some do), you'll need the new routing client before cutover. Requests for early access to the shard map, test fixtures, or cutover-date exceptions all go through approval — no informal asks in chat. Send approval requests to the person named below.

named custodian: Brivan Eliath Quenox Frador

Team,

The Hollowpine queue-depth autoscaler is live in staging. It polls depth every 15s and scales workers between 2 and 40. Config lives in the `scaler.toml` shipped with each release; do not hardcode thresholds. All metrics calls require auth. Future maintainers: rotate quarterly. Use the staging credential below for your integration tests.

session JWT of yawep-yawep = eyJhbGciOiJIUzI1NiIsInR5cCI6IkpXVCJ9.eyJzdWIiOiI3pWF3_In0.aXYsHiog